- Riddles. 14/6/1938
Q. Its red and its yellow and its span green - the King cannot touch it no more than the Queen.
A. The rainbow.
Q Why is the letter "T" like Easter?
A. because it comes at the end of Lent.
Q. Twenty sick (six) sheep went out a gap, one of them died and how many came back?
A. Nineteen.
Q. I have a little cow, she lies against the wall she eats all she gets and drinks none atall?
A A fire.
Q. As I looked out my grandfather's window I saw the dead carrying the live?
A. A motorcar.
Q. What part of the train comes into the station first.
A. The noise.- Informant
